Product Information

Fmoc-(S)-3-amino-3-(3-trifluoromethylphenyl)propionic acid is a versatile building block widely utilized in peptide synthesis and drug development. This compound features a unique trifluoromethyl group, which enhances its biological activity and stability, making it particularly valuable in medicinal chemistry. Its Fmoc (9-fluorenylmethoxycarbonyl) protecting group allows for easy incorporation into peptide chains, facilitating the synthesis of complex peptides with high purity and yield. Researchers and industry professionals appreciate its application in the design of peptide-based therapeutics, where precise amino acid sequences are crucial for efficacy.

In addition to its role in peptide synthesis, this compound can be employed in the development of novel materials and as a reagent in various organic transformations. Its distinctive properties enable the exploration of new chemical pathways and the creation of innovative compounds. With its robust performance and adaptability, Fmoc-(S)-3-amino-3-(3-trifluoromethylphenyl)propionic acid stands out as an essential tool for researchers aiming to push the boundaries of peptide chemistry and drug discovery.

Applications

Fmoc-(S)-3-amino-3-(3-trifluoromethylphenyl)propionic acid is widely utilized in research focused on:

  • Peptide Synthesis: This compound serves as a key building block in the synthesis of peptides, particularly in solid-phase peptide synthesis (SPPS), allowing for the creation of complex peptide structures with high purity and yield.
  • Drug Development: Its unique trifluoromethyl group enhances the pharmacological properties of peptides, making it valuable in the development of new therapeutic agents that may exhibit improved efficacy and selectivity.
  • Bioconjugation: The compound can be used in bioconjugation techniques, facilitating the attachment of peptides to various biomolecules, which is essential for creating targeted drug delivery systems.
  • Research in Neuroscience: It plays a role in the design of neuropeptides, which are crucial for understanding and treating neurological disorders, thereby contributing to advancements in neuroscience research.
  • Analytical Chemistry: The compound is utilized in analytical methods for characterizing peptide structures, helping researchers ensure the accuracy and reliability of their findings in various studies.
